Questions You May Have. How many calories are in a Medicine Ball? A grande, 16-ounce Starbucks Medicine Ball contains 130 calories, according to Starbucks nutrition information. Furthermore, it has 32 grams of carbohydrates, 30 grams of which are sugars.

Does a medicine ball have caffeine?

Yes, a Starbucks Medicine Ball Tea contains caffeine, although it’s minimal. For instance, a 16 ounce Medicine Ball contains 16-25 mg of caffeine according to Starbucks nutrition data. Specifically, the caffeine comes from the Jade Citrus Mint green tea bag. The other tea bag is herbal and therefore is caffeine-free.

How heavy of a medicine ball should I get?

When it comes to the recommended medicine ball sizes, the American Council of Exercise (ACE) recommends that medicine balls weighing between 4 and 15 pounds are the best starting points.

What are medicine balls filled with?

It can come in small sizes (like a softball) or larger ones, resembling a volleyball or beach ball. The shell can be made from many materials, including nylon, vinyl, leather, dense rubber, or polyurethane, and the insides are often stuffed with sand, gel, or just inflated with air.

How do I choose a medicine ball?

The key to a successful medicine ball workout is to use a size or weight that provides enough resistance while encouraging speed. You’ll want to choose a medicine ball weight that’s just heavy enough to provide resistance, but not so heavy that it hinders your speed and athletic motion.

Does a Medicine Ball have a lot of sugar?

The medicine ball is loaded with sugar. The lemonade contains it, as does the honey, which add up to a whopping 30 grams total, or 7.5 teaspoons. That’s one and a half teaspoons over the recommended maximum of six teaspoons of added sugar daily for women—and that’s just in this one drink.
